Note 1 The default setting for this function is 0 To request the status of the reset function use command INI Note 2 The inhibition time is reset when following an alarm the input is back to idle within a shorter time than the interval of inhibition restore will take place at the next input activation The device lets you define how long the alarm condition must be for a certain input so that the circuit sends the notifications The setting is made through the following messages Command OSS1 ss defines the length of the observation time regarding input 1 ss is the time in seconds 12 futurel USER MANUAL TDG140 Example How to set a ten second observation time for input 1 OSS1 10 Command OSS2 ss defines the length of the observation time regarding input 2 ss is the time in seconds Example how to set a 59 second observation time for input 2 OSS2 59 Note The observation time can be set between 1 and 59 seconds The default value for both inputs is 1 second Command OSS requests the current observation time setting regarding the inputs Example OSS Regarding the inputs activity it is possible to define for each of them the notification message about presence of tension as well as for the one for absence of tension Command TIN1A xxxx defines the message the device sends to the numbers in the list enabled to receive alarm SMS when input 1 gets the alert of tension presence is the message you want

SMS when input 2 gets the alert of tension absence is the message you want to write 100 characters max including spaces The text message does not accept the semi colon and all letters must be capitali zed The default message is ALARM INPUT 2 LOW Example How to set the alarm text NO TENSION ON INPUT 2 for input 2 in absen ce of tension TIN2B NO TENSION ON INPUT2 Note Keep in mind that messages will be sent from the remote control according to the settings made in relation to the logic level intended as an alarm The operation mode the timing and the status requests of the input relays can be managed by SMS Command OUTx ON activates the specified output relay x is the output relay 1 or 2 Example How to activate output relay 1 OUT1 ON Example How to activate output relay 2 OUT2 ON Command OUTx OFF disables the specified output relay x is the output relay 1 or 2 Example How to disable output relay 1 OUT1 OFF Example How to disable output relay 2 OUT2 OFF Command STA requests the condition of the remote outputs Example STA Command OUTx ss inverts the condition of the specified relay for the desired time x is output relay 1 or 2 ss is a period between 1 and 59 seconds Example How to disable output relay 1 if already active or how to activate it if not active for 10 seconds OUT1 10 In case of black out command RIPx stores the relay status and restores it when po wer is

12. back on x has a value of 1 to enable restoring to disable it The default value is 1 Example How to enable the relay status recovery on start up RIP1 Example How to disable the relay status recovery on start up 14 futurel USER MANUAL TDG140 RIPO Command RIP requests the current setting for relay status recovery Example RIP The remote gives the possibility to send a customizable SMS to the phone number on the first position in the list whenever it is fed Command AVVx enables o disables the afore mentioned function x has a value of 1 to enable it O to disable it The default value is Example How to enable the function to send a start up SMS AVV1 Example How to disable the function to send a start up SMS AVVO Command TSU xxxxxxxxxxxx sets the text of the message the remote sends during Start up is the message 100 characters max including spaces The text message does not accept the semi colon and all letters must be capitali zed The default phrase is SYSTEM STARTUP Example How to set the start up message TDG140 DEVICE ON TSU DEVICE TDG140 ON The following are the 5 SMS commands regarding the interaction with the DTMF commands Command FILx enables or disables the filter on incoming calls x has a value of 1 to prevent access to the numbers not in the list O to allow the remote to answer calls coming from any phone number The default value is 1 Example how

14. its condition with the time set by means of the command TIMx tt see Table of command and configuration SMS Button allows to control the temporary inversion of RL 1 Button 4 allows to control the temporary inversion of RL2 The remote control replies to both commands by means of 1 beep to indicate the relay has been temporarily activated 2 beeps to indicate the relay has been put to rest It is also possible to know the inputs current state using the keypad Button 5 is used to request the status of relay RL 1 Button 6 is used to request the status of relay RL2 The remote control replies to both commands by means of 1beep to indicate the relay is active 2 beeps to indicate the relay has been put to rest The following two commands are used to manage the inputs Button 7 is used to request the status of input IN1 Button 8 is used to request the status of input IN2 The remote control replies to both commands by means of 1 beep to indicate the corresponding optocoupler is conductive tension in the input 2 beeps to indicate the corresponding optocoupler is idle no tension or insufficient tension Any time once the command is considered finished you can order the remote to close the communication Button 0 is used to close the communication with the device The remote control replies to both commands by means of 5 beeps to indicate the communication will be closed futurel 19 TDG140

16. to enable the filter on incoming calls FIL 1 Command 5 sets the module so that after answering the incoming calls requests the access password to the DTMF command x has a value of 0 for free access to the command 1 if instead once the reply from the remote is obtained the DTMF com mand can be performed only by those people who have the password The default value is O He following commands that can be sent from a phone number in the list regard the definition of monostable activation time that extends the state inversion intervals in the impulsive command over the 9 seconds that can be set with the phone keypad Command TIM1 xx extends the state intervention interval in the impulsive command of relay 1 xx is the time in seconds between 00 and 59 futurel 15 140 USER MANUAL Example how to set a 15 second activation time for relay 1 TIM1 10 Command TIM2 xx extends the state intervention interval in the impulsive command of relay 2 xx is the time in seconds between 00 and 59 Example how to set a 25 second activation time for relay 2 TIM2 25 Note he default value is 5 seconds Always on outputs there is a command that shows the current set time for monosta ble mode without calling the remote and making a query from the DT MF Command TIM lets you know the current set time for monostable mode for both relays Example TIM As already mentioned at the beginning of Chapter 11 the system accepts messa
17. to write 100 characters max including spaces The text message does not accept the semi colon and all letters must be capitali zed The default message is ALARM INPUT 1 HIGH Example How to set the alarm text TENSION ON INPUT 1 for input 1 in presence of tension TIN1A TENSION ON INPUT 1 Command TIN1B xxxx defines the message the device sends to the numbers in the list enabled to receive alarm SMS when input 1 gets the alert of tension absence is the message you want to write 100 characters max including spaces The text message does not accept the semi colon and all letters must be capitali zed The default message is ALARM INPUT 1 LOW Example How to set the alarm text NO TENSION ON INPUT 1 for input 1 in absen ce of tension TIN1B NO TENSION ON INPUT1 Command TIN2A xxxx defines the message the device sends to the numbers in the list enabled to receive alarm SMS when input 2 gets the alert of tension presence is the message you want to write 100 characters max including spaces The text message does not accept the semi colon and all letters must be capitali zed The default message is ALARM INPUT 2 HIGH Example How to set the alarm text TENSION ON INPUT 2 for input 2 in presence futurel 13 140 USER MANUAL of tension TIN2A TENSION ON INPUT2 Command TIN2B xxxx defines the message the device sends to the numbers in the list enabled to receive alarm

19. 5 6 8 if the latter are already enabled to receive alarm SMS for example because previously activated they will continue receiving those message Note 2 The password is required In addition to SMS the device can also make short calls to ring the phones of the people which number is in the list that must be advised of a change of input status the ringtone draws people s attention faster than a SMS which may arrive with some delay Command VOCxxxxxxxx ON allows the number on the specified position to receive a ringtone on the inputs status x is the position of the number s in the list Example How to allow phone numbers on positions 1 and 5 in the list to receive the ringtone on input status VOC15 ON Note 1 The command will only modify memory position 1 and 5 and not the state 10 futurel USER MANUAL TDG140 of the other ones 2 3 4 6 7 8 if the latter are already enabled to receive alarm ringtone for example because previously enabled they will continue receiving it Note 2 The password is required Command VOOCxxxxxxxx OFF does not allow the number in the specified position to receive the ringtone on the input status x is the position of the number s in the list Example How not to allow phone numbers on positions 2 and 4 in the list to receive the ringtone on input status VOC24 OFF Note 1 The command will only modify memory position 2 and 4 and not the state of the other ones 1 3 5 6 7 8 if t

USER MANUAL TDG140 TDG140 GSM Remote Control with DTMF Technical data e GSM GPRS Module SIM900 Quad 850 900 1800 1900 MHz GPRS multi slot class 10 8 GPRS mobile station class Output power Class 4 2 W 850 900 MHz Class 1 1 W 1800 1900 MHz GSM external stylus antenna e Power supply 9 to 32 Vdc stabilized or with Li lon battery 800 1 000 mA h dle current 50 mA idle peak up to 1A Relay outputs 2 to control low tension loads SELV type 60 Vdc Max current relay contacts 10 A e Digital inputs 2 logic 1 5 32 V logic 0 0 V Dimensions 103x67x28 LxWxH mm Operating temperature 10 C 55 14 F 131 F Weight approx 100 grams Complies with EN 60950 1 2006 EN 301489 7 V 1 3 1 EN 301511 V9 0 2 future 140 USER MANUAL 10 11 12 13 14 15 TABLE OF CONTENTS Ing eel gts ia d ua E D ER 3 Safety instructions nnne 3 General 4 Operating 4 mig er ee ee aE EEA 5 5 Connectors and LEDS 2 6 Installing the 5 7 clap

28. he latter are already enabled to receive alarm ringtone for example because previously enabled they will continue receiving it Note 2 The password is required By default all phone numbers in the first eight positions of the list provided they are stored receive a notification of the input alarm via SMS or short call ringtone The same applies if the reset command which restores the initial settings is sent to the remote control Commands regarding the setting of the level that defines the alarm condition are listed below Command LIVx A sets a HIGH level as the alarm condition for inputs IN1 or IN2 the input is in alarm under tension x stands for input 1 or 2 Example How to set a HIGH level of alarm activation on input 2 LIV2 A Command LIVx B sets a LOW level as the alarm condition for inputs IN1 or IN2 the input is in alarm in absence of tension x stands for input 1 or 2 Example How to set a LOW level of alarm activation on input 2 LIV2 B Command LIVx V sets a level variation as the alarm condition for inputs IN1 or IN2 the input is in alarm after going from a LOW level to a HIGH level or the opposite x stands for input 1 or 2 Example How to set a level variation as alarm activation on input 1 LIV1 V Please note that By default inputs are activated in presence of tension Command LIV requests the alarm activation level regarding the inputs Example LIV You can define a period of time known as i
29. nput inhibition time following an alarm ac futurel 11 140 USER MANUAL tivation during this time the device does not control the level on a specific input that period may be set between 0 and 59 prime minutes The default value is 5 minutes Command NI1 mm sets the inhibition time on input 1 mm is the time in prime minu tes Command NI2 mm sets the inhibition time on input 2 mm is the time in prime minu tes Example How to establish that following an alarm IN1 cannot determine other alarms for two minutes INI1 02 Command INI requests the current inhibition time setting regarding the inputs Example INI When it is necessary to control sensors that monitor frequently variable phenomena and to receive real notifications about the current events it might be necessary to ignore the inhibition time The remote can temporarily disable input by input the pre set inhibition time with the following commands Command TIZ1x resets the inhibition time if input 1 is idle x is the setting parameter if O no reset if 1 reset Example How to reset inhibition time on input 1 TIZ11 Example How to disable the inhibition time reset function on input 1 TIZ10 Command 22 resets the inhibition time if input 2 is idle x is the setting parameter if O no reset if 1 reset Example How to reset inhibition time on input 2 TIZ21 Example How to disable the inhibition time reset function on input 2 TIZ20

32. serious material loss or personal injury the tracks connecting the relay contacts to the terminal are sized considering a load activation which absorbs 10 A for short periods of time 5 Proper use This device is designed for the remote switching of electric and electronic units via the GSM network and for the remote retrieval of status information of its inputs by means of SMS messages automatically generated after those inputs change status A different use is not allowed 6 Description The TDG140 is a bidirectional remote control module easy to install and simple to use With the TDG140 it is possible to remotely control two relays in monostable or bistable mode by means of special SMS commands with a password or by means of DTMF tones sent from any mobile phone it is possible to store up to 8 telephone numbers to which the device sends SMS and phone calls when according to the settings made during the configuration it considers the inputs active Apart from the TDG140 you will need a valid SIM Card from any network provider GSM 900 1800 MHz When using a prepaid SIM Card always check the available futurel 5 140 USER MANUAL credit so that in case of alarm a SMS can be sent Typical fields of application regard the control of power loads switching on and off alarm devices the reception via SMS of information concerning the state of door sen sors movement sensors level sensors etc 7 Connectors and L
33. st Here are four categories four commands that manage the outputs the inputs the com munication and the setting of the device Here we present and describe all commands that can be sent to de device via SMS Note Every command must be CAPITALIZED and written without spaces Command PWDxxxxx pwd changes the password xxxxx is the new password nu meric five digits and pwd is the current password the default password is 12345 Example 54321 as the new password and 12345 as the current password PWD54321 12345 Note the password is required Command NUMx 39nnnnnnnnnnn pwd stores a phone number to 8 numbers 19 digits each in the device x is its position in the list nnnnnnnnnn is the phone number with country code 39 for Italy pwd is the current password Example how to enter number 3498911512 in the 8th position NUM8 393498911512 12345 Note the password is required only if you try to save the number in a position already occupied by another one or when the command is sent from a phone that is not in the list If the command is sent from an unknown phone the password is always required Command NUMx pwd removes a phone number from the list x is its position in the list pwd is the current password Example how to delete the 4th phone number from the stored list NUM8 393498911512 12345 Note the password is required Command NUM pwd requests the list of phone numbers currently stored in the device pwd is
